What is the IB Math Standard Level Practice Exam?
The IB Math Standard Level Practice Exam serves as an essential educational tool designed to evaluate students' mathematical competencies. This exam encompasses a variety of math problems including arithmetic sequences, Venn diagrams, and quadratic functions. Spanning 90 minutes, it features a structured format that allows students to fill in their answers directly within the document, enhancing overall interactivity.
